中级安全工程师审查内容是什么之代码安全
中级安全工程师审查内容是什么?这是一个让许多备考者感到困惑的问题。尤其是在代码安全方面,中级安全工程师需要具备哪些技能和知识?如何进行有效的代码安全审查?这些问题不仅关系到考试的通过概率,更关系到未来职业发展。今天,我们就来深入探讨一下中级安全工程师在代码安全审查中的职责和重要性。
代码安全审查的重要性
代码安全审查是确保软件系统安全的重要环节。中级安全工程师在这一过程中扮演着至关重要的角色。他们需要具备扎实的编程基础和丰富的安全知识,能够识别和修复潜在的安全漏洞。通过代码安全审查,可以有效预防和减少因代码缺陷引发的安全风险,保障系统的稳定运行。例如,在开发过程中,工程师们会使用静态代码分析工具来检测代码中的潜在问题,如缓冲区溢出、SQL注入等。
代码安全审查的具体内容
中级安全工程师在进行代码安全审查时,需要关注以下几个方面:
输入验证:确保所有外部输入都经过严格的验证,防止恶意输入导致的安全问题。
权限管理:合理设置用户权限,避免未授权访问和操作。
加密技术:对敏感数据进行加密处理,保护数据在传输和存储过程中的安全。
日志记录:详细记录系统运行状态和异常情况,便于后期审计和故障排查。
安全配置:确保系统配置符合安全标准,关闭不必要的服务和端口。
代码安全审查的方法和技巧
中级安全工程师在进行代码安全审查时,可以采用以下几种方法和技巧:
静态代码分析:使用静态代码分析工具,如SonarQube、Fortify等,对代码进行全面扫描,发现潜在的安全漏洞。
动态测试:通过模拟攻击场景,对系统进行动态测试,检验其在实际运行环境中的安全性。
代码审查:组织团队成员进行代码审查,互相检查代码中的安全问题,提高代码质量。
安全培训:定期组织安全培训,提升团队成员的安全意识和技术水平。
持续集成:将安全检查集成到持续集成流程中,确保每次代码提交都经过安全审查。
中级注册安全工程师报考指南
为了帮助大家更好地备考中级注册安全工程师,以下是一些关键的报考信息:
报考条件
| 学历条件 | 从事安全生产业务年限 |
|---|---|
| 安全工程及相关专业大学专科学历 | 满5年 |
| 其他专业大学专科学历 | 满6年 |
| 安全工程及相关专业大学本科学历 | 满3年 |
| 其他专业大学本科学历 | 满4年 |
| 安全工程及相关专业第二学士学位 | 满2年 |
| 其他专业第二学士学位 | 满3年 |
| 安全工程及相关专业硕士学位 | 满1年 |
| 其他专业硕士学位 | 满2年 |
| 博士学位 | 满1年 |
| 取得初级注册安全工程师职业资格后 | 满3年 |
报名流程
① 查看公告:关注官方发布的考试公告,了解新的报名信息。
② 用户注册:在指定的报名网站上进行用户注册,填写个人信息。
③ 填报信息:按照要求填写报名表,上传相关证明材料。
④ 选择承诺:阅读并同意诚信考试承诺书。
⑤ 网上交费:完成网上支付,确认报名成功。
⑥ 准考证打印:在规定时间内打印准考证,核对考试信息。
⑦ 考试:按时参加考试,遵守考场纪律。
⑧ 查询成绩:考试结束后,登录报名网站查询成绩。
⑨ 资格审核:通过资格审核,确认成绩有效。
⑩ 证书发放:成绩合格后,领取中级注册安全工程师职业资格证书。
考试科目及题型
| 科目 | 题型 | 分值 |
|---|---|---|
| 安全生产法律法规 | 单选70题×1分,多选15题×2分 | 满分100分 |
| 安全生产管理 | 单选70题×1分,多选15题×2分 | 满分100分 |
| 安全生产技术基础 | 单选70题×1分,多选15题×2分 | 满分100分 |
| 安全生产专业实务 | 单选20题×1分,案例选择题10分,案例主观题70分 | 满分100分 |
中级安全工程师在代码安全审查中的职责和重要性不容忽视。通过深入理解代码安全审查的具体内容、方法和技巧,以及掌握报考条件和考试流程,考生可以更加从容地备考,并在未来的职业生涯中发挥重要作用。希望本文能为大家提供有益的参考和指导。


我的课程
我的订单
我的消息
听课指南




